Frequently Asked Questions about Tulsa
How much are Studio apartments in Tulsa?
There are currently 296 Studio Apartments in Tulsa with rent ranges from $585 to $3,650 with an average price of $1,083.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Tulsa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Tulsa ranges from $537 to $3,199 with an average monthly rent of $1,099.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Tulsa c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Tulsa range from $709 to $3,699.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,459.
How expensive are Tulsa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 196 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Tulsa on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$930 to $5,280 - averaging $1,874 for the location.
